THE HONOURABLE DR. JUSTICE D.NAGARJUN CRIMINAL REVISION CASE No.254 of 2011 O R D E R:
This Criminal Revision Case is filed aggrieved by the Judgment dated 24.02.2010 on the file of learned Judicial Magistrate of I Class, Special Mobile Court cum XI Metropolitan Magistrate, Cyderabad, L.B.Nagar in C.C. No.1086 of 2006 (Old C.C. No.1171 of 2005 on the file of learned II Metropolitan Magistrate, Cyderabad), wherein the respondents No.2 and 3/Accused found not guilty for the offence punishable under Section 498 - A of Indian Penal Code and were acquitted under Section 248 (1) of Criminal Procedure Code.
02. No representation on behalf of respondents No.2 and 3. Ms. P.Deepika, learned counsel appearing on behalf of Sri Bijetha Borukatti, learned counsel for the Petitioner, on record as well as Sri S.Ganesh, learned Assistant Public Prosecutor representing the State/Respondent No.1 are present.
03. It is submitted by Ms. P.Deepika, learned counsel appearing on behalf of Sri Bijetha Borukatti, learned counsel for the Petitioner, on record, that the petitioner and respondent No.2 are living together as wife and husband under one roof, after settling the issues. Therefore, the learned counsel for the Petitioner sought permission of this Court to withdraw this Criminal Revision Case.
04. In view of the above submission, permission is accorded and this Criminal Revision Case is liable to be dismissed.
05. Accordingly, this Criminal Revision Case is dismissed as withdrawn. There shall be no order to as costs.
As a sequel, pending Miscellaneous Applications, if any, shall stand closed.
